Output 95c61c1c210244b98381930ad1b0b6b130b53a5c62fc9f1fe72c240cfc22d7c9:1

value
42345000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f5bce1a6300c9017954b154e1f37cd14aa3522 OP_EQUAL
address
9sLw8H9JmKZRp8A1maaAUk8VdgdekJPkxw
transaction
95c61c1c210244b98381930ad1b0b6b130b53a5c62fc9f1fe72c240cfc22d7c9